Propagation has been poor to downright awful this week. I hope for
improvement. With the sun setting earlier each night at least the lower
bands are opening. Space Weather reports 91 as their solar flux index
with a sunspot number of 66. Some auroras so we know there is an
incoming wind though it does cause noise like a sand storm.
